#56bfef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#56bfef is composed of 33.7% red, 74.9% green and 93.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64% cyan, 20.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 198.8 degrees, a saturation of 82.7% and a lightness of 63.7%. #56bfef color hex could be obtained by blending #acffff with #007fdf. Closest websafe color is: #66ccff.

#56bfef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#56bfef has RGB values of R:86, G:191, B:239 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0.2, Y:0,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 5685231.
